Every small business owner wants to appear on Google when customers search for their products or services. The challenge is that SEO often feels complicated and expensive. But here’s the good news—you don’t need to hire an expert to see results. By applying a few SEO tips for small business owners, you can improve your visibility, attract new customers, and compete with larger brands online.
In this post, you’ll discover 10 easy SEO strategies you can start using today.
- Optimize Titles and Meta Descriptions
Your title tag and meta description are the first things users see on Google. Include your focus keyword and make the text clickable. For example, instead of writing “Home | XYZ Café,” write “Best Coffee & Snacks in Delhi – XYZ Café.” Optimized titles improve both SEO and click-through rates.
- Install Rank Math for On-Page SEO
One of the simplest SEO tips for small business owners is using the Rank Math plugin. It guides you in adding keywords, improving readability, and structuring your pages. Rank Math also integrates with Google Analytics and Search Console, so you can track your SEO performance directly in WordPress.
- Target Long-Tail Keywords
Broad keywords like “shoes” are very competitive. Instead, target long-tail keywords such as “affordable women’s sports shoes in Mumbai.” These attract visitors who are closer to buying. Tools like Google Keyword Planner and Ubersuggest help you find these terms.
- Publish High-Quality Blog Content
Blogging is one of the most effective SEO strategies for small business websites. Write posts that answer common customer questions. A dentist, for example, might write “10 Ways to Prevent Cavities Naturally.” Each blog post gives your website another chance to rank on Google.
- Make Your Website Mobile-Friendly
More than 60% of searches come from mobile devices. A mobile-responsive site keeps visitors engaged and helps with higher rankings. Test your site with Google’s Mobile-Friendly Test and make sure text, images, and buttons display correctly on smaller screens.
- Increase Website Speed
A slow website not only frustrates users but also hurts rankings. Compress large images, remove unused plugins, and use a caching plugin. Even reducing load time by one second can improve conversions and keep visitors on your site longer.
- Optimize Images with Alt Text
Google can’t “see” images, so it relies on alt text. Describe each image with relevant keywords. For example, use “Chocolate birthday cake from XYZ Bakery Delhi” instead of “image123.jpg.” This helps your site rank in Google Images and boosts accessibility.
- Improve Local SEO with Google Business Profile
For small businesses, local SEO is essential. Claim and optimize your Google Business Profile by adding your address, phone number, opening hours, and high-quality photos. Encourage satisfied customers to leave reviews—these reviews increase trust and rankings in local search.
- Add Internal and External Links
Internal linking connects your blog posts and service pages, helping search engines understand your site structure. For example, link your “Healthy Hair Tips” blog to your “Hair Spa Service” page. Also, include external links to trusted sources for added credibility.
- Track and Improve SEO Performance
SEO is a continuous process. Use Google Analytics and Google Search Console to monitor your traffic and keyword rankings. Rank Math makes tracking even easier by showing keyword performance inside your WordPress dashboard. Regularly update old posts to keep them relevant.
Final Thoughts on SEO for Small Business Owners
Implementing these SEO tips for small business owners doesn’t require a huge budget or technical expertise. With consistency, you can improve your Google rankings, attract local customers, and grow your business online. Start with small steps today, and you’ll see measurable results over time